Bank Supervision: Observations on the National Bank and Thrift Examiners' Conference

Summary

The Comptroller General testified on the National Bank and Thrift Examiners' Conference held in Baltimore, Maryland, in December 1991. Hosted by four federal financial institution regulators who issued the "Interagency Policy Statement on the Review and Classification of Commercial Real Estate Loans" in November 1991, the conference sought to review with senior examination personnel the policy statement and other issues related to credit availability. The conference did not allay GAO's concerns about the inconsistency between the policy statement and the objectives of recently passed bank reform legislation. The "broader view" approach to loan evaluation and classification and the seeming shift in the burden of proof that the examination workforce must carry is troublesome to GAO and potentially dangerous to the safety and soundness of the banking system.
